To get the true essence of Eskiboy, really you just got to listen to his war dubs, get the most hype, most jokes, most random bars ("yo and Dot Rotten are scared of sunflowers" seriously does anyone actually know what that means? I still can't decide if he's being literal or this had a double meaning or W/E).
So I made a playlist with a mixup of 20 of my favourite sends and war dubs from Wiley. MOST of these tracks I ripped from the Tunnel Vision mixtape series, and a couple are radio rips or from elsewhere. War Report
Looks like the war is on, Wiley's back at Skepta 24 hours after the In The Country dub dropped.. He must of been ready and waiting..
Honestly though I was anticipating a decent 140bpm track. This had some nice lines but I'm not feeling the Giggs influence on none of this so far. I've never heard Skepta sounding so basic as he does on that track. Wiley had some nice bars still. You've been watching too much 50 and Rick Ross..
